eHarmony and REO Speedwagon launch sweetheart contest

In celebration of eHarmony’s 10th anniversary and REO Speedwagon’s summer concert tour, the online relationship site and award-winning band have teamed up for the “Keep on Loving You” Video Contest that will run in select cities across the country during REO’s “Love on the Run” tour with Pat Benatar.

eHarmony success couples in multiple markets will have the exclusive chance to showcase their chemistry and compete for a chance to win an ultimate sweethearts’ VIP package to attend a “Love on the Run” tour date in their town with an experience that includes luxurious first-class dinner served by REO Speedwagon.

In a unique and exclusive partnership, REO Speedwagon and eHarmony have joined together to offer these success couples a truly once-in-a-lifetime opportunity. Beginning today, lucky couples who have connected through eHarmony can submit their best rendition of an REO Speedwagon song on YouTube where entries will be voted on by the general public.

The grand prize winner will be personally selected by REO Speedwagon from the three videos with the most votes in each market. The winning couple will receive a pair of tickets to the show and a romantic dinner for two served by the members of REO Speedwagon backstage, complete with VIP transportation.

“So many REO songs come from our exploring the mysteries of love, understanding and surviving the challenges of long term love and finding new ways to say ‘I Love You.’ I feel like our band has a lot in common with eHarmony, so partnering with them seems like a natural fit,” said lead singer Kevin Cronin. “I hear all the time from people who tell me they have fallen in love to our songs, walked down the aisle to our songs, gotten their first taste of love while an REO song was playing. The romantic dinner backstage is going to be so cool. Plus, our wives are going to love the idea of us waiting on someone else.”

ABOUT THE “LOVE ON THE RUN” TOUR
Bringing the songs of two historic rock bands to stages all across America, REO Speedwagon and Pat Benatar will visit over 35 cities across the country for their co-headlining summer tour, “LOVE ON THE RUN,” kicking off on June 24th. Their music will take fans back to their early ‘80s explosion onto the Billboard charts, where both artists enjoyed #1 and Top 10 positions for the better part of the decade and will carry on through their career with music that continues to define their excellence in song craftsmanship and performance. Edwin McCain and Keaton Simons will each be joining these two legendary acts on various stops along the tour. All tickets are on-sale now.

“LOVE ON THE RUN” is dedicated to raising awareness about hunger among American school children by partnering with “Blessings in a Backpack,” a non-profit organization that provides weekend meals to school children in need. During their recent “Can’t Stop Rockin Tour,” REO Speedwagon and Styx raised over $300k for school kids, helped to open 20 schools and helped feed nearly 4k children a weekend for a full year as a result of their partnership with Blessings in a Backpack.
